Chico transforms the solar conversation
If you have spoken with good friends that went solar several years earlier, their economics may not match your own. California's existing internet payment structure usually positions even more worth on electrical energy you make use of directly in the home than on electrical energy you send back to the grid throughout the middle of the day. That means an excellent installer in Chico need to ask really particular questions regarding your use pattern.
Do you run a/c hardest in the late afternoon and early evening? Do you work from home and usage plenty of power while the sunlight is up? Are you billing an electrical automobile overnight? Do you have a swimming pool pump, well pump, or watering tons that can be moved into daytime hours? These details form whether a simple rooftop selection suffices, whether panel positioning need to prefer west-facing manufacturing, or whether a battery is worth major attention.
This is just one of the most convenient ways to different thoughtful solar companies from aggressive sales teams. The weaker companies speak virtually entirely concerning yearly manufacturing and tax obligation credit reports. The stronger ones hang out on tons timing, utility rate plans, and what your bill will likely resemble month by month.
Not all solar providers do the very same job
Homeowners typically utilize the terms reciprocally, but there is a functional distinction between solar providers, photovoltaic panel providers, and full-service solar companies.
Some firms primarily sell. They create leads, send out an expert, authorize the agreement, and then hand the job to a third-party installer. Some are equipment-focused and highly guide you towards a certain panel or inverter line. Others are up and down incorporated and take care of sales, style, allowing, installation, and solution themselves. None of these models is immediately poor, however you need to recognize which one you are dealing with.
If one business states it is making use of "our team" and another says "our installation partner," ask what that implies in ordinary language. That pulls authorizations? That submits utility documents? Who manages roof penetrations if there is a leak claim? Who checks the system after it is activated? House owners typically discover far too late that the company that won their rely on the sales process is not the firm responsible when something goes sideways.
In Chico, where local track record still matters, liability has actual worth. A supplier with a close-by workplace and a service group that actually covers Butte Region can be worth more than a firm with a slightly lower cost and a telephone call center several hours away.
Start with your roof and your expense, not the sales pitch
Before you compare quotes, obtain clear on both things that form your alternatives most: the problem of your roofing and the pattern of your electric use.
If your roofing is nearing completion of its life, solar may still make sense, but it transforms the sequencing. Eliminating and reinstalling panels for a re-roof is expensive and troublesome. A good installer will certainly bring this up prior to you do. If a sales associate plays down an older composite roofing system and promotes a rapid trademark, take that as a warning.
Electric bills require the same degree of honesty. A carrier needs to request for at least year of usage preferably, since Chico homes frequently turn greatly in between mild-season intake and heavy summer season demand. A residence that makes use of moderate electricity the majority of the year but spikes in July and August needs a different design method than a high-use home with steady year-round consumption.
I have actually seen property owners focus on offset percent without recognizing what it conceals. A quote that assures 100 percent annual offset can seem perfect, yet still leave big summer season evening bills if the system is sized or oriented badly for real household habits. On the other hand, a quote for 75 to 85 percent annual countered combined with better daytime self-consumption or a battery might carry out better monetarily. Context issues greater than the heading number.
The quote is not the contrast, the presumptions behind it are
Two proposals can look comparable while defining very various end results. This is where lots of people shed the thread.
Ask each service provider to stroll you via the assumptions utilized in the proposition. What annual production estimate are they utilizing? What color losses are assumed? Which roofing system airplanes are consisted of? Are they forecasting result cautiously or pushing hopeful numbers? What energy price rise did they make use of in financial savings forecasts? A projection can be practically defensible and still be also glowing to count on.
Pay focus to just how the firm clarifies degradation, as well. All panels lose a little bit of result with time, yet reputable business provide this as a regular operating truth, not as a concealed issue or a hand-waved afterthought. They must additionally have the ability to discuss inverter method in functional terms, especially if your roof covering has several positionings or intermittent shade from trees usual in older Chico neighborhoods.
One sales expert may tell you that one of the most effective panel is automatically the best choice. That is not always real. Costs panels can make sense on smaller sized roofing systems or roof coverings with restricted functional area. However on a wide, unhampered roof covering, a slightly cheaper panel with solid service warranty support may provide much better worth per dollar. Excellent solar panel providers describe the trade-off as opposed to assuming every property owner must acquire the top rack option.
Equipment quality is more than the panel brand
People often tend to fixate on the panel brand name due to the fact that it shows up and simple to compare. In technique, the inverter and the installer matter equally as much, sometimes more.
Panels rarely fall short considerably. More frequently, problems arise from poor format, bad channel runs, careless flashing, weak communication hardware, or an inverter arrangement that does not match the website. The craftsmanship side of solar is much less interesting than panel electrical power, but it is where lasting contentment often lives.
When comparing solar companies, take a look at the full tools pile. Ask what panel design is recommended, what inverter kind is being utilized, how monitoring jobs, and what mounting system will sit on your roofing. A supplier that can clarify why they picked string inverters for one home and microinverters for one more is typically assuming at the ideal degree. A supplier that uses one conventional bundle to everybody might still be great, yet only if your home occurs to fit that bundle well.
Battery discussions deserve the very same examination. Chico blackouts and Public Safety and security Power Shutoff worries have actually pressed extra home owners to consider storage space. The appropriate battery configuration depends on whether you want whole-home back-up, important tons only, or mainly expense savings. Those are really different objectives. If the proposition discusses a battery as if it fixes everything at the same time, request for a more sensible explanation.

The repayment structure can misshape the comparison
A solar proposition can be made to look eye-catching virtually regardless of the hidden worth if the financing terms are stretched or padded. This is where house owners need to slow down down.
A reduced monthly payment does not always imply a much better offer. It might just mirror a longer car loan term, a dealership fee constructed right into the financed cost, or presumptions concerning using a tax obligation credit scores without delay. If you compare one company on cash cost and one more on financed monthly repayment, you are not comparing apples to apples.
Ask for the cash rate even if you intend to finance. After that ask for the funded cost, rate of interest, term, and any fees rolled into the funding. Some of the most polished solar companies near me style marketers win offers since they make funding really feel pain-free, not because they are providing the most effective general value.
Leases and power purchase contracts can still fit particular scenarios, particularly for home owners who do not desire maintenance obligation or who can not make use of a tax credit score efficiently. However they require particularly mindful analysis. Escalators, transfer terms when offering the home, and acquistion arrangements all issue. If a business becomes vague when you ask about those information, action back.

Reviews assist, however only if you review them like a skeptic
Online testimonials work, but they should not be trusted. Look for patterns instead of star counts.
A firm with glowing reviews that discuss smooth sales and fast installation may still have weak long-term service. Evaluations created promptly after set up commonly miss out on the tougher part, which is support after permission to operate. Attempt to identify comments concerning service warranty follow-through, keeping an eye on concerns, response times, and just how the company took care of surprises.
Also notification what customers do not state. If dozens of testimonials applaud friendliness yet extremely couple of review system performance, communication throughout permitting, or post-install support, you are primarily seeing sales satisfaction, not functional quality.
It deserves asking each company for current neighborhood referrals. Not curated testimonial video clips, but real clients in or near Chico that had a comparable job range. A brief telephone call can inform you more than fifty sleek online reviews.

Compare timelines, not simply totals
Installation timing in solar usually looks simple from the exterior. In reality, a project relocates through website assessment, style, engineering, allowing, scheduling, inspection, and energy authorization. Hold-ups can occur at a number of stages, and sincere companies will say so.
Ask the length of time tasks are taking right now in Chico, not for how long they absorb concept. Also ask what part of the timeline is under the company's control and what component relies on neighborhood permit review or energy handling. A confident assurance of a really quick set up can be enticing, however if it ignores actual management steps, it is not a sign of performance. It is an indicator that the sales associate is overpromising.
This also matters if you are trying to align solar with a reroof, a major panel upgrade, or battery back-up prior to high-fire season. A provider that collaborates well with roofing contractors and electricians can save you weeks of frustration.
Service after setup is where online reputations are earned
The day your system is energized is not completion of the connection. It is the start of the component that evaluates the company.
Monitoring sites shed connection. Inverters throw mistake codes. Roofing system job becomes essential years later. Homeowners redesign and include electric loads. Energy invoicing requires analysis. These are regular realities, and the high quality of assistance you receive typically depends less on the https://tysonhylc764.capitaljays.com/posts/how-to-contrast-solar-providers-and-solar-panel-providers-in-chico-2 equipment than on the company's service structure.
Ask that you call if checking quits reporting. Ask whether service demands are managed by internal specialists or subcontractors. Ask what action time is normal for non-emergency problems. Excellent solar providers respond to these inquiries without appearing protective, due to the fact that they understand service is part of the product.
This is one reason the cheapest proposal is commonly not the least expensive gradually. Saving a small amount upfront can really feel hollow if every future problem develops into a game of voicemail tag.

How much does it cost to install solar panels on a 2,000 sq ft home in Chico?
A solar system for a 2,000-square-foot home typically costs between $18,000 and $40,000 before incentives. Actual costs depend on electricity usage, system size, equipment quality, and installation complexity. Homes with higher energy consumption may require larger systems. Available incentives can significantly reduce the final cost.

How long does it take for solar panels to pay for themselves in Chico?
Solar panel payback periods typically range from 6 to 12 years, depending on system cost, energy usage, electricity rates, and available incentives. Higher utility costs can shorten the payback period. After reaching payback, ongoing energy savings may continue for many years. Actual timelines vary by household and system performance.
What happens if my roof needs replacement after solar installation in Chico?
If a roof requires replacement after solar panels have been installed, the system usually needs to be removed and reinstalled. This process can add additional labor and project costs. Many homeowners choose to evaluate roof condition before installing solar panels to avoid future disruptions. Proper planning can help minimize long-term expenses.
